WebApr 6, 2024 · To be eligible for an Income Eligible Child Care Subsidy, parents must meet both income eligibility and service need requirements (see above) established by EEC. Financial Requirements Income eligibility is based on the income and the size of the family. Families headed by caretakers are exempt from financial eligibility guidelines. WebOn May 10, the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services’ Administration for Children and Families (ACF) released guidance for how states can use the $24.9 billion in child care stabilization grant funds in the American Rescue Plan Act (ARPA).
